ICYMI: Donalds Joins Mornings With Maria

WASHINGTON – This morning, Congressman Byron Donalds (R-FL) joined Mornings with Maria on Fox Business Network to discuss the Trump administration's commitment to healthcare reform and a recent video posted by Democratic members of Congress openly calling for military defiance and insurrection.

"It's time to redo the regulations in Obamacare; they are not working for the American people":

"What is expect is that if there's going to be some arrangement on short-term subsidies, you have to rework the regulatory framework of Obamacare. What it has done is created these massive Cadillac health insurance plans that are unaffordable. The premiums are around $2,000 a month now. The deductibles are $12, $14, $16,000 a year. Most Americans don't have the disposable income to actually access the plan, to actually pay the deductible to access these plans. So, a lot of the reforms that members are talking about, I've been involved in some of these meetings, is around low-premium plans, low deductible plans that actually still provide access to basic healthcare while also having some other elements of catastrophic plans, which only get triggered in the event of a major health abnormality. Still providing coverage to people with pre-existing conditions, but then bringing some commonsense back to this marketplace because the regulatory framework left by the Democrats, and I will add, Maria, the Democrats voted for this type of health insurance unanimously without Republican support. What it's led to are people having a health insurance policy that they do not have the resources to access. So, the policy itself really has no value to hardworking Americans. If we're going to do a deal on subsidies, there has to be major changes to the regulatory framework of Obamacare.
